Atticworks......you should be able to find something.

Just go thru the lodging section.....link at the top of the page.

A few of my favorites:

Sunbreeze...pool, A/C, restaurant, bar, beachfront...I don't recommend the dive shop next to them...not theirs...sorry.

Tides Hotel....nice rooms with fridge, A/C... full bath with TUB!....LOL....beachfront, bar, within 10 minute walk to town.

Lily's....budget....clean...A/C....fridge....beachfront...restaurant....in front of Amigos Del Bar Dive Shop.

Holiday Hotel...beachfront...restaurant....bar....gift shop...nice rooms with or without A/C...right in front of Bottom Time Dive Shop....which I highly recommend.

If you stay at any of these....you should not need to rent a cart unless you just want to tour around. They are all in town or within close proximaty.

We too were cancelled at the Seven Seas in November and were lucky enough to stay at the Holiday Hotel. It's a great location, better than the Seven Seas (we discovered while there) and the staff is wonderful. We had wanted a condo so we could do our own cooking, but got a room with a frige at the Holiday and took our own hot plate and camping cookware and picnic plates. It worked out fine.
